Completed Here's what I completed during the month: 20mm Platoon 20 French Indo-China War Vietnamese.  I completed four pairs of porters, a mule team and the artillery crew this month.  Porters and mules were a vital part of the Vietnamese war effort.  They add something a little different to the table and they've come out rather well.  I based the recoilless rifle and all the crew on small magnetised bases then made a base out of magnetic receptive sheet as I'd done for my Ancient Germans and Imperial Romans.  This gives me the flexibility of...

Completed Here's what I completed during the month: 20mm Platoon 20 Vietnamese civilians.  The majority of the painting for these was done last month, with just some highlights, varnishing and basing to be completed.  They're nice "classic" wargames miniatures, not over fussy or detailed and for those newbies only used to plastic or 3D print figures probably appear basic, to which I’d say bollocks. 15mm 16th Century arquebusiers.  I finished off the rebasing of 22 Essex Miniatures figures onto single 15mm round magnetised bases.  This gives the flexibility for keeping them as singles for  skirmish and forming units for larger games.
